Concept & Overview

Electric vehicles operate on a fundamentally different system compared to internal combustion engine (ICE) cars. At their core, EVs rely on rechargeable batteries, electric motors, and sophisticated software to deliver power and efficiency. The absence of a traditional engine eliminates many maintenance tasks associated with gasoline vehicles, such as oil changes and spark plug replacements. Instead, EV maintenance focuses on battery health, tire care, brake system inspections, and software updates. These differences highlight the need for owners to adapt their maintenance routines to the unique demands of electric propulsion. By grasping the fundamentals of EV technology, drivers can better appreciate why specific maintenance practices matter and how they contribute to a reliable, eco-friendly driving experience.

Key Features & Highlights

  • Battery Care: The battery pack is the heart of an EV, and its longevity depends on proper charging habits, temperature management, and regular diagnostics. Avoiding frequent deep discharges and extreme heat or cold can significantly extend battery life.
  • Regenerative Braking System: EVs use regenerative braking to recover energy during deceleration, reducing wear on brake pads. While this system is efficient, periodic inspections ensure it functions optimally and components like brake fluid are checked.
  • Tire Maintenance: EVs tend to be heavier due to battery weight, which accelerates tire wear. Regular rotations, proper inflation, and alignment checks help maintain traction and efficiency.
  • Cooling System Checks: Battery thermal management systems prevent overheating. Ensuring coolant levels are adequate and the system is free of leaks is critical for safety and performance.
  • Software Updates: Many EVs receive over-the-air updates that improve performance, range, and features. Keeping software current is essential for accessing the latest enhancements and fixes.
  • High-Voltage Component Inspections: Wiring, connectors, and electrical systems require periodic checks for corrosion or damage. Certified technicians should handle high-voltage repairs to ensure safety.

What are the common misconceptions about EV maintenance?

One widespread myth is that EVs require no maintenance at all. While they have fewer moving parts, critical components like tires, brakes, and batteries still need attention. Another misconception is that charging an EV is complicated or time-consuming. In reality, most drivers charge their vehicles overnight at home, and public charging networks continue to expand rapidly. Some also believe EVs are more prone to breakdowns, but modern EVs undergo rigorous testing and often come with extended warranties covering battery systems.

Are electric vehicles more expensive to maintain than gasoline cars?

Generally, EVs cost less to maintain over their lifetime compared to gasoline vehicles. The absence of oil changes, fewer brake replacements due to regenerative braking, and reduced wear on engine components contribute to lower upkeep expenses. However, battery replacement can be costly if not covered under warranty. Routine maintenance costs for EVs are typically lower, but initial purchase prices may be higher due to battery technology. Over time, the savings in fuel and repairs often offset the higher upfront investment.

How often should I service my electric vehicle?

Service intervals vary by manufacturer, but most EVs require a check-up every 12 months or 12,000 miles, whichever comes first. During these visits, technicians typically inspect battery health, tire condition, brake systems, and software updates. Some manufacturers recommend more frequent tire rotations and cabin air filter replacements to ensure optimal performance and comfort. Always refer to your vehicle’s owner manual for manufacturer-specific guidelines tailored to your model.

Can I perform maintenance on my EV myself?

While some basic tasks like tire rotations or air filter replacements can be done at home with the right tools, most EV maintenance requires specialized knowledge and equipment. High-voltage systems pose serious safety risks, so tasks such as battery diagnostics or coolant servicing should only be handled by certified professionals. Always follow the manufacturer’s recommendations and consult a qualified technician for complex repairs or upgrades to avoid voiding warranties or causing damage.

Practical Guidance & Solutions

Transitioning to an EV-friendly maintenance routine starts with understanding your vehicle’s unique needs. Begin by familiarizing yourself with the owner’s manual, which outlines specific maintenance schedules and recommendations for your model. Invest in a home charging station if possible, as consistent, moderate charging habits help preserve battery health. Avoid exposing your EV to extreme temperatures for prolonged periods, and consider parking in shaded areas or garages when possible. Regularly check tire pressure and alignment, as proper inflation enhances range and tire lifespan.

Schedule annual or bi-annual service appointments with a certified EV technician to conduct comprehensive diagnostics. These professionals can assess battery performance, update software, and inspect high-voltage components for signs of wear. Keep a log of maintenance activities to track progress and identify patterns in wear or performance issues. If you notice unusual noises, reduced range, or warning lights, address them promptly to prevent minor issues from escalating.
